A go-jazz recording of a special live stage held in 2016 with the WDR Big Band, one of Europe’s most prominent big bands that has achieved many collaboration live performances with big names in the jazz world, as an FM sound source. In 2016, Joshua Redman released a collaboration album with Brad Mehldau, and that topic became a priority in the world of jazz, but he also performed a gorgeous live performance that was released this time. Joshua Redman is said to have never lived with his father, Dewey Redman, so he made his debut in 1993 without any influence from his father, and established his current position as an orthodox tenor player. At this live show, Joshua Lettman and the WDR Big Band will have a synergistic effect that will allow you to fully enjoy orthodox yet fresh and cool jazz. The set list is also picked up from past albums, and the arrangements that can only be heard with this title are exquisite. Live at Philharmonie, Cologne, Germany 02/23/2016 Disc 1 1.Jia A Jug 2.Soul Dance 4.Sweet Sorrow Disc 2 1.Yesterdays 2.Tribalism 3.Wish 4.Jazz Crimes Joshua Redman(ts) Richard DeRosa (cond) Olivier Peters, Frank Jacobi(ts) Johan Helen, Malte Desrschnabel(as) Ruud Breuls,Rob Bruynen, Andy Haderer, John Marshall(tpt) Ludwig Nuss, Shannon Barnett, Andy Hunter, Mattis Cederberg(tb) Jens Neufang (bs) Frank Chastenier(p)
